  JOB DESCRIPTION

  A Pediatric Congenital Heart Nurse Navigator, guides patients and families through treatments and care experiences. You will play a pivotal role serving as direct liaison and point of contact for patients and their families, to provide resources and assistance in accessing clinical and supported care services offered in the Guerin Family Congenital Heart Program, Smidt Heart Institute. The position involves direct patient care, comprehensive coordination of care, and eliminating barriers to timely and seamless care.

  Job Summary:

  Establishes and revises the plan of care for appropriateness on an on-going and timely basis as directed by the patient’s care team.

  Coordinates patient care activities and management of clinical data throughout all phases of patient care from initial referral to follow-up. Arranges for clinical services, evaluates clinical data, and triages clinical questions/ concerns to the appropriate members of the interdisciplinary team.

  Demonstrates clinical competence in the assessment and intervention for patient, family, or significant other requiring emotional support, coping support and care for significant life changes. Coordinates support services within the health system and community to meet patient/family needs.

  Able to communicate effectively in English in person, writing, and on the telephone; work independently; perform basic math and statistical functions; multitask and think critically with ability to pay attention to detail and accuracy; work well under pressure; organize and prioritize workload.

  Able to set goals and assess results in accordance with the highest standards.

  Able to build consensus around a common vision.

  The Nurse Navigator guides patients and families through treatments and care experiences.

  Collaborates with clinical staff to provide care and referrals.

  Leads process and quality improvement activities to provide the best possible care.

  Able to prepare timely and accurate documentation and reports.

  Deliver care with sensitivity and respect, advance care through development of new ideas and technology.

  Helps coordinate and facilitate with patients’ part of research and clinical trials.

  Consults with physicians and other health care professionals as indicated regarding patient care issues and quality of care issues related to patients. Supports the leadership and clinical teams by providing progress reports on patient care.

  Actively participates in quality improvement measures and projects as requested and directed. Recommends, develops, and implements policy/protocol revisions and performance improvement activities based on current standards.

  Establishes, coordinates and continuously evaluates supportive care plan with goals and interventions based upon treatment and individual patient/caregiver needs, preferences, beliefs and values.
